
一、在Excel中设置空格默认值的方法包括使用公式、数据验证、VBA宏、条件格式。其中,使用公式是一种简单而有效的方法,可以根据需要灵活设置默认值。
使用公式的方法可以通过在目标单元格内输入特定的函数来实现。例如,可以使用IF函数来检查单元格是否为空,如果为空则自动填充默认值。这个方法不仅可以节省时间,还可以确保数据的完整性和一致性。下面将详细介绍这一方法及其他几种常用的设置空格默认值的方法。
一、使用公式设置空格默认值
公式是Excel中非常强大的工具之一,通过一些简单的函数组合,可以在单元格为空时自动填充默认值。
1、IF函数
IF函数是Excel中最常用的函数之一,可以检查一个条件并根据条件的真假返回不同的值。使用IF函数可以很方便地实现空格默认值的设置。
例如,假设你希望在A列的单元格为空时填充默认值"默认值",可以在B列输入以下公式:
=IF(A1="", "默认值", A1)
这个公式的意思是,如果A1单元格为空,则在B1单元格显示"默认值",否则显示A1的内容。
2、使用ISBLANK函数
ISBLANK函数用于检查某个单元格是否为空,可以与IF函数结合使用来设置默认值。例如:
=IF(ISBLANK(A1), "默认值", A1)
这个公式与前面的IF函数类似,只是用ISBLANK函数来明确检查A1是否为空。
3、组合使用IF和VLOOKUP函数
有时,你可能需要根据多个条件来设置默认值,这时可以使用IF和VLOOKUP函数的组合。例如:
=IF(A1="", VLOOKUP("默认值", 默认值表, 2, FALSE), A1)
这个公式的意思是,如果A1为空,则在默认值表中查找并返回对应的默认值。
二、使用数据验证设置空格默认值
数据验证功能可以帮助确保输入数据的有效性,同时也可以用于设置默认值。
1、创建下拉列表
通过创建一个包含默认值的下拉列表,可以确保用户在单元格为空时选择预设的默认值。步骤如下:
- 选择需要设置默认值的单元格或区域。
- 点击“数据”选项卡,选择“数据验证”。
- 在“允许”下拉菜单中选择“序列”。
- 在“来源”输入框中输入默认值,如“默认值1,默认值2,默认值3”。
- 点击“确定”完成设置。
这样,当用户点击单元格时,会出现一个包含默认值的下拉列表,用户可以从中选择适当的默认值。
2、使用自定义公式
通过使用自定义公式,可以在数据验证中实现更加复杂的默认值设置。例如,可以使用以下公式来设置默认值:
=IF(A1="", "默认值", A1)
在数据验证对话框中选择“自定义”,然后在“公式”框中输入上述公式即可。
三、使用VBA宏设置空格默认值
VBA(Visual Basic for Applications)是一种强大的编程语言,可以用于自动化Excel中的各种任务,包括设置空格默认值。
1、编写简单的VBA宏
以下是一个简单的VBA宏示例,它会在特定范围内的单元格为空时填充默认值:
Sub SetDefaultValue()
Dim cell As Range
For Each cell In Range("A1:A10")
If IsEmpty(cell) Then
cell.Value = "默认值"
End If
Next cell
End Sub
将上述代码复制到VBA编辑器中并运行即可。
2、自动化宏执行
可以通过设置事件触发器来自动执行宏,例如在工作表激活时自动填充默认值:
Private Sub Worksheet_Activate()
Call SetDefaultValue
End Sub
将上述代码添加到工作表的代码模块中,当工作表被激活时,宏将自动执行。
四、使用条件格式设置空格默认值
条件格式可以用于突出显示特定条件下的单元格,同时也可以用于设置默认值。
1、创建条件格式规则
通过创建条件格式规则,可以在单元格为空时应用特定格式,例如填充默认值。步骤如下:
- 选择需要设置默认值的单元格或区域。
- 点击“开始”选项卡,选择“条件格式”。
- 选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。
- 在“格式设置此公式确定的单元格”框中输入以下公式:
=ISBLANK(A1)
- 点击“格式”,选择适当的格式(例如填充颜色),然后点击“确定”。
2、应用条件格式
当单元格为空时,条件格式将自动应用,用户可以通过视觉提示来填充默认值。
通过上述方法,可以在Excel中灵活地设置空格默认值,从而提高工作效率和数据准确性。选择适合的方法,可以根据具体需求和使用场景进行调整和优化。
相关问答FAQs:
Q1: 如何在Excel中设置单元格的默认值为空格?
A1: 在Excel中,你无法直接设置单元格的默认值为空格。然而,你可以通过以下步骤达到类似的效果:
- 选中你想要设置默认值为空格的单元格或单元格范围。
- 点击鼠标右键,在弹出菜单中选择“格式单元格”选项。
- 在“数字”选项卡下,选择“自定义”类别。
- 在“类型”框中输入一个空格字符(即空格键),例如:" "。
- 点击“确定”按钮保存设置。
这样,当你在该单元格输入任何内容后按下回车键,该单元格会自动显示为空格。
Q2: 我如何在Excel中将单元格的默认值设置为空格字符?
A2: 如果你想将Excel单元格的默认值设置为空格字符,你可以按照以下步骤进行操作:
- 打开Excel,并选中你想要设置默认值为空格的单元格或单元格范围。
- 在Excel的顶部菜单栏中选择“数据”选项卡。
- 点击“数据验证”按钮。
- 在弹出的对话框中,选择“设置”选项卡。
- 在“允许”下拉菜单中选择“自定义”选项。
- 在“公式”框中输入以下公式:
=IF(A1<>"", A1, " ")(假设你要设置的单元格是A1)。 - 点击“确定”按钮保存设置。
现在,当你在该单元格输入任何内容后按下回车键,如果输入为空格,则单元格会显示为空格,否则会显示你输入的内容。
Q3: 如何在Excel中设置默认值为一个空格字符的单元格?
A3: 如果你想在Excel中为一个单元格设置默认值为一个空格字符,你可以按照以下步骤进行操作:
- 选中你想要设置默认值为空格的单元格。
- 在公式栏中输入一个空格字符(即空格键)。
- 按下回车键以保存该设置。
现在,该单元格的默认值将被设置为一个空格字符。当你在该单元格输入任何内容后按下回车键,如果输入为空格,则单元格会显示为空格,否则会显示你输入的内容。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4706993